Explore Diverse Lab Roles
The scope of lab jobs near Bloomington-Bedford is surprisingly vast:
1. Laboratory Technicians: These professionals perform routine laboratory tests, maintain equipment, and assist in research experiments. They play a crucial role in ensuring accurate data collection and analysis.
2. Research Assistants: Often involved in more complex tasks, research assistants support scientists and researchers by preparing samples, analyzing data, and contributing to experimental design.
3. Clinical Laboratory Scientists: Specializing in medical diagnostics, these experts interpret test results, ensure lab quality control, and work closely with healthcare providers to deliver accurate patient care.
4. Part-Time Laboratory Assistants: Ideal for students or individuals seeking flexible schedules, part-time positions offer the chance to gain valuable experience while balancing other commitments.
5. Temporary Lab Work Bloomington: Short-term assignments are perfect for those new to the field or looking to explore different areas of laboratory science.

Building a Compelling Resume and Cover Letter
Crafting a winning application is essential for finding lab work in Bloomington-Bedford. Here are some key tips:
Resume:
- Highlight relevant education, certifications (e.g., CLT certification for clinical laboratory technicians), and prior laboratory experience.
- Include specific skills like data analysis software proficiency, molecular biology techniques, or microscope operation.
- Tailor your resume to the specific job description, emphasizing qualifications that match the requirements.
Cover Letter:
- Express your enthusiasm for the specific lab or research area where you’re applying.
- Explain why you are interested in working in Bloomington-Bedford and how your skills and experience align with their goals.
- Showcase your passion for medical science and your commitment to contributing to scientific advancement.
Prepare for Interviews
Interviews for lab jobs in Bloomington-Bedford often involve a combination of technical knowledge assessment, problem-solving exercises, and behavioral questions:
-
Brush Up on Scientific Concepts: Review fundamental laboratory techniques, data interpretation, and safety protocols relevant to the role.
-
Practice Common Interview Questions: Prepare thoughtful answers to questions like "Why do you want to work in a lab?" or "Describe a challenging situation you encountered during an experiment."
-
Showcase Your Communication Skills: Effective communication is crucial in laboratory settings. Be prepared to demonstrate your ability to explain complex scientific concepts clearly and concisely.
-
Ask Informed Questions: Show genuine interest in the position and the lab by asking insightful questions about the work environment, research projects, and opportunities for professional development.
